The first project I created using specialty papers and embellishments that I have had in my stash and I just could not bring them together in a way I liked until now.  The hearts on the background paper are flocked and I thought a little would go a long way but I finally decided to use the whole sheet and go big or go home as the saying goes. 
"Together is Best"
Used a glitter sticker and added some scrap paper flags.
I stamped the circle then placed a heart on top.  I cut the heart from the paper behind the picture...an easy way to incorporate part of the paper without buying 2 sheets!  
Added some fun fabric embellishments along side the picture.  I just love how the blue sets off the red!

After using stencils to paint the quote, I used Washi tape as a border and added some Little Yellow Bicycle Dimensional accents.



I also have a bonus project for you today!  We moved into a new house and I am trying to find ways to make it our own.  Both of my projects lend themselves to that. 


For this project I took a wooden letter and wrapped it in washi tape.
    

I used glue dots to add the laser cut wooden cross and washi tape to create a hanger with a bow.
